WebIn order to determine whether a burn is first, second or third degree, it is important to look for certain signs and symptoms. Some of the key indicators of a first degree burn include redness, swelling, and tenderness on the skin’s surface. WebMassaging the burn scar is a technique we use to soften the scar tissue. It can help release any adhesions (bands of scar tissue that connect two body parts that are usually separate) in the scars.
